J. PRESS x FARIBAULT MILL
Founded in 1865 in a historic mill nestled along the Cannon River in Minnesota, Faribault Mill began as a small operation producing durable woolen blankets for a growing frontier. Inside their “new” mill, built in 1892, century-old machines still run beside modern equipment. Fifth-generation craftspeople carry on techniques passed down through decades—blending tradition and innovation to produce blankets, throws, scarves, and accessories with unmatched comfort, strength, and timeless design. Established in 1938 and based in Brittany, France, Armor-lux is known around the world for its iconic Breton stripe marinière, inspired by the official French Merchant Navy uniform. Founded in 1902 in New Haven, Connecticut, J. Press pioneered what is now known as “Ivy style” and is synonymous with classic American menswear. These two historic brands have come together to create a limited-edition capsule that brings the best of French seafaring style to New England, featuring long-sleeve and short-sleeve Breton stripe marinières, a classic canvas bleu-de-travail (the original blue chore coat), as well as canvas shorts, a relaxed twill fisherman’s pant, a striped crewneck knit, and a heritage quarter-zip.
